WebVali Myers (1930-2003) artist, vagabond and agitator, was born near Box Hill and moved to Melbourne at the age of eleven. Leaving home at fourteen, she worked in factories before becoming a dancer with the Melbourne Modern Ballet Company. When she was nineteen she went to Paris.
